I’m
writing to thank you and Dr. Nattis from
freeing me from the 35-year tyranny of
glasses. As a physician, I was concerned
about any problems that I might have with
LASIK, but the staff and Dr. Nattis explained
the procedure and possibilities in an
objective professional manner, putting
my mind at ease.
The results thus far are even better than
I expected. I was able to see clearly
after a few hours, and by the next day,
I was driving and performing household
repair work. I played golf 3 days after
the procedure and went back to work after
4 days. It’s great to wake up in
the morning and not have to fumble for
my glasses, or having to juggle 3 sets
of glasses (regular, sunglasses and bifocals),
making sure I always have the right one
handy. |
Yesterday
I was playing golf in the humidity, and
it started to rain. It was a wonderful
experience not having to wipe raindrops
off my glasses between shots, or clearing
away fog. I know this may not seem like
much, but it really impressed me how great
the results are. I can’t wait for
the wintertime, when I can finally go
skiing without fogging up. |
When
people ask me about the procedure (and
they have already), I will recommend Dr.
Nattis and your facility without reservation.
